  1. Believe Acoustic is the third remix album by the Canadian singer Justin Bieber. It was released on January 29, 2013, by Island Records as the follow-up to his second remix album, Never Say Never: The Remixes. It is Bieber's second acoustic album, following My Worlds Acoustic. The album has acoustic and live versions of songs from his third studio album Believe, as well as three new recordings.

Justin Bieber treats fans to intimate, at-times-hushed renditions of songs from his platinum-selling album Believe, including the falsetto-brushed “Boyfriend.” Bieber also delivers two new tracks: the tenderhearted, metaphor-laden “Yellow Raincoat” and “I Would,” an uplifting jam with a sunny melody (and the album’s only non-acoustic track).
